The Company

About Energy Bay

-Backed by impact capital and the parent group of brands like Solar Bay and Diamond Energy, it rapidly scaled through strategic acquisitions and partnerships. -Delivered headline projects like Australia’s largest behind-the-meter solar system at McCain Foods and major rooftop + battery installations at Moorebank Logistics. -Operates via brands: Solar Bay (asset construction, financing, embedded networks) and Diamond Energy (100% renewables energy retail). -Typical offerings include embedded networks, PPA-backed renewable installations, onsite solar, battery storage, and EV charging infrastructure. -Notable for pioneering embedded energy systems in major shopping centres, logistics hubs, and convention centres with modern financing models. -Grew through acquisitions like QuadSol and Diamond Energy, gaining full-stack capabilities from design and build to generation and retail. -Built and operates one of Australia’s first behind-the-meter solar + storage systems topping a major potato processing plant.
